“In today’s design landscape, colour is no longer just an afterthought – it’s a critical component that helps to define spaces and reinforce brand identity. The demand for customisation has reached unprecedented levels in the solid surface industry, with bespoke colours becoming the hallmark of distinctive design.
The most significant shift we’re witnessing is the move away from the standard colour palette toward truly individual solutions.
Historical colour trends in solid surfaces have typically followed broader design movements, from the minimalist whites and neutrals of the early 2000s to the bold statements of the 2010s. Today’s trend, however, is less about following predetermined styles and more about alignment with specific brand identities and unique project visions.
At Velstone we’ve embraced this transformation by developing unparalleled colour matching capabilities that allow Architects, Designers and Corporates to break free from conventional limitations. Our technology can match any RAL and Dulux colours, replicate digital images, and even reproduce physical objects for precise colour replication in solid surfaces.
Every year the emphasis on project individuality is becoming significant and with that the demand for niche colours. Recently, we provided custom solid surfaces for the current Manchester City hotel project, delivering surfaces with precise colour matching and custom thicknesses for 350 rooms. Similarly, a prep school in Suffolk approached us for laboratory worktops in specific colours and thicknesses which no one else could supply within the allocated lead time and budget.
Hotels, restaurants, airports, and cruise ships increasingly demand solid surfaces that precisely match their brand colours, creating cohesive environments that reinforce their identity throughout every touchpoint of the customer experience. Our work with major brands like Virgin Atlantic and Holiday Inn demonstrates how solid surfaces have become integral to maintaining brand consistency.
Interestingly, while custom colours continue to drive the market, we are also witnessing a renaissance for marble-effect finishes, which are coming back into fashion. These elegant surfaces deliver the look of natural stone with the practical benefits of solid surface materials, and we maintain a competitive edge as one of the most cost-effective suppliers for the marble-effect finish.
There is no doubt, however, that the future of solid surface design lies in the ability to deliver truly bespoke colour solutions to allow unique spaces to be created.”
